
New Delhi: Iqbal Kaskar, brother of underworld don Dawood Ibrahim, has been arrested on charges of extortion.
Thane Anti-Extortion Cell picked up Kaskar from his Mumbai residence. Former encounter specialist Pradeep Sharma who just took charge of the Thane AEC earlier this month led Kaskar's arrest.
A senior police official said that Kaskar is not alone as two more names of builders from Thane and Mumbra had cropped up in connection to the case. One builder who is under the radar was arrested in an alleged abetment to suicide case two years ago.
Police said that Kaskar had been threatening builders on behalf of Dawood Ibrahim and was demanding huge extortion money as a cut for his brother.
Many of these builders who are from Thane, Ulhasnagar, Dombivli had allegedly paid huge sums of extortion money to Kaskar. In fact, one builder who had suffered significant losses during the demonetisation and was under debt, had filed the complaint against Kaskar.
This isn't Kaskar's first brush with the law. He was arrested in an extortion acase in February 2015 and granted bail. A real estate agent, Mohammed Salim Shaikh, had filed a complaint accusing Kaskar and his men of assaulting him and demanding Rs 3 lakh.
Kaskar, who is Dawood's youngest brother, was wanted in a murder case. He was also alleged to have played a role in the controversial Sara Sahara case where a building came up illegally on government land, but a court acquitted him in both the cases in 2007.
